import { DockerPackConfig } from './types.ts';
/**
* Common utils for setting up pack config
*/
export class PackConfigUtil {
/**
* Docker setup
*/
static dockerInit(cfg: DockerPackConfig): string {
return `FROM ${cfg.dockerImage}`;
}
/**
* Install docker pages in either apk or apt environments
*/
static dockerPackageInstall(cfg: DockerPackConfig): string {
const { os, packages } = cfg.dockerRuntime;
if (packages?.length) {
switch (os) {
case 'alpine': return `RUN apk --update add ${packages.join(' ')} && rm -rf /var/cache/apk/*`;
case 'debian': return `RUN apt update && apt install -y ${packages.join(' ')} && rm -rf /var/lib/{apt,dpkg,cache,log}/`;
case 'centos': return `RUN yum -y install ${packages.join(' ')} && yum -y clean all && rm -fr /var/cache`;
case 'unknown':
default: throw new Error('Unable to install packages in an unknown os');
}
} else {
return '';
}
}
/**
* Install docker pages in either apk or apt environments
*/
static dockerNodePackageInstall(cfg: DockerPackConfig): string {
const out: string[] = [];
for (const item of cfg.externalDependencies ?? []) {
const [name, directive] = item.split(':');
switch (directive) {
case 'from-source':
out.push(`RUN npm_config_build_from_source=true npm install ${name} --build-from-source`); break;
default:
out.push(`RUN npm install ${name}`); break;
}
}
if (out.length) {
out.unshift(`WORKDIR ${cfg.dockerRuntime.folder}`);
}
return out.join('\n');
}
/**
* Setup docker ports
*/
static dockerPorts(cfg: DockerPackConfig): string {
return (cfg.dockerPort?.map(x => `EXPOSE ${x}`) ?? []).join('\n');
}
/**
* Setup docker user
*/
static dockerUser(cfg: DockerPackConfig): string {
const { os, user, group, uid, gid } = cfg.dockerRuntime;
if (user === 'root') {
return '';
} else {
switch (os) {
case 'alpine': return `RUN addgroup -g ${gid} ${group} && adduser -D -G ${group} -u ${uid} ${user}`;
case 'debian':
case 'centos': return `RUN groupadd --gid ${gid} ${group} && useradd -u ${uid} -g ${group} ${user}`;
case 'unknown':
default: throw new Error('Unable to add user/group for an unknown os');
}
}
}
/**
* Setup Env Vars for NODE_OPTIONS and other standard environment variables
*/
static dockerEnvVars(cfg: DockerPackConfig): string {
return [
`ENV NODE_OPTIONS="${[...(cfg.sourcemap ? ['--enable-source-maps'] : [])].join(' ')}"`,
].join('\n');
}
/**
* Setup docker runtime folder
*/
static dockerAppFolder(cfg: DockerPackConfig): string {
const { folder, user, group } = cfg.dockerRuntime;
return [
`RUN mkdir ${folder} && chown ${user}:${group} ${folder}`,
].join('\n');
}
/**
* Docker app files copied with proper permissions
*/
static dockerAppFiles(cfg: DockerPackConfig): string {
const { user, group, folder } = cfg.dockerRuntime;
return `COPY --chown="${user}:${group}" . ${folder}`;
}
/**
* Entrypoint creation for a docker configuration
*/
static dockerEntrypoint(cfg: DockerPackConfig): string {
const { user, folder } = cfg.dockerRuntime;
return [
`USER ${user}`,
`WORKDIR ${folder}`,
`ENTRYPOINT ["${folder}/${cfg.mainName}.sh"]`,
].join('\n');
}
/**
* Common docker environment setup
*/
static dockerWorkspace(cfg: DockerPackConfig): string {
return [
this.dockerPorts(cfg),
this.dockerUser(cfg),
this.dockerPackageInstall(cfg),
this.dockerAppFolder(cfg),
this.dockerAppFiles(cfg),
this.dockerEnvVars(cfg),
].filter(x => !!x).join('\n');
}
/**
* Common docker file setup
*/
static dockerStandardFile(cfg: DockerPackConfig): string {
return [
this.dockerInit(cfg),
this.dockerWorkspace(cfg),
this.dockerNodePackageInstall(cfg),
this.dockerEntrypoint(cfg)
].join('\n');
}
}
